原文:說一下我對Mvvm模式的理解

使用WPF Mvvm開發一年多,期間由於對Mvvm模式的理解不足,遇到了很多問題,也繞了很多彎子 網上提供的Mvvm的示例比較簡單,實際項目中的需求也各種各樣。不過經過幾個項目,也有了一些對Mvvm模式的理解: . Mvvm是什么,Mvvm是怎么來的 Mvvm模式廣泛應用在WPF項目開發中,使用此模式可以把UI和業務邏輯分離開,使UI設計人員和業務邏輯人員能夠分工明確。 Mvvm模式是根據MVP模 ...

2012-11-28 22:00 29 101289 推薦指數:

查看詳情

理解一下vue的mvvm模式

1.傳統前端開發mvp模式 m:數據層 view:視圖層 presenter:控制層 這三層的通訊簡單來說,就是''數據層''和''視圖層''之間通過"控制層"進行通訊的,控制層主要是通過操作dom對象,進行二者之間的通訊 2.vue是mvvm模式 m:數據層 v:視圖層 vm ...

Fri Jul 06 18:07:00 CST 2018 0 942
一下對Java中的volatile的理解

前言 volatile相關的知識其實自己一直都是有掌握的,能大概講出一些知識,例如:它可以保證可見性;禁止指令重排。這兩個特性張口就來,但要再往深了問,具體是如何實現這兩個特性的,以及在什么場景使用volatile,為什么不直接用synchronized這種深入和擴展相關的問題,就回答的不好 ...

Fri Nov 06 16:26:00 CST 2020 1 663
.一下你了解的幾種設計模式

一、設計模式的分類 總體來說設計模式分為三大類: 創建型模式,共五種: 工廠方法模式 抽象工廠模式 單例模式 建造者模式 原型模式。 結構型模式,共七種: 適配器模式 裝飾器模式 代理模式 外觀模式 ...

Tue Jul 09 05:19:00 CST 2019 0 1066
MVC,MVVM模式理解

基本上,我們的產品就是通過接口從數據庫中讀取數據,然后將數據經過處理展示到用戶看到的視圖上。當然我們還可以從視圖上讀取用戶的輸入,然后通過接口寫入到數據庫。但是,如何將數據展示到視圖上,又如何將用戶的 ...

Sat Jul 13 01:54:00 CST 2019 0 392
MVVM模式理解

MVVM模式理解 MVVM全稱Model-View-ViewModel是基於MVC和MVP體系結構模式的改進,MVVM就是MVC模式中的View的狀態和行為抽象化,將視圖UI和業務邏輯分開,更清楚地將用戶界面UI的開發與應用程序中業務邏輯和行為的開發區分開來。 描述 MVVM模式簡化了界面 ...

Sun Jul 12 18:31:00 CST 2020 0 724
MVVM模式理解

  MVVM 是Model-View-ViewModel 的縮寫,它是一種基於前端開發的架構模式,其核心是提供對View 和 ViewModel 的雙向數據綁定,這使得ViewModel 的狀態改變可以自動傳遞給 View,即所謂的數據雙向綁定。   Vue.js 是一個提供了 MVVM 風格 ...

Wed Mar 07 07:44:00 CST 2018 3 25300
阿里二面面試題:請你一下對受檢異常和非受檢異常的理解

面試題: 請你一下對受檢異常和非受檢異常的理解? 面試考察點 考察目的: 異常的設計,在程序開發中時非常重要的。好的異常設計能夠合理清晰的反饋程序的問題,提供排查思路。同時,還能夠很好的處理資源回收問題。所以作為有經驗的程序員,必須要了解異常,以及異常的差異和特性。 考察人群 ...

Tue Nov 02 02:45:00 CST 2021 0 308
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M